Subspace clustering (SC) is a hotspot in data analysis and machine learning. There exists much literature addressing this topic and most of which cannot handle large scale data. Although anchor graph learning is introduced to SC, there is still a problem that anchors cannot preserve the subspace structure of original data and spectral clustering process is still implemented slowly.
